Suhaan Posted December 24, 2024 Posted December 24, 2024 (edited) "Seven years ago, we were quite flat, we want to create exciting an contest and exciting Test matches, so we will leave more grass, that brings the bowlers into equation. But it is still good for batting once the new ball goes off. We keep 6mm grass and we would monitor that as we get in," Page elaborated. https://www.moneycontrol.com/sports/cricket/india-vs-australia-boxing-day-test-melbourne-weather-forecast-and-mcg-pitch-report-article-12897150.html Edited December 24, 2024 by Suhaan
